Disc handling
• Do not touch the playback side of the disc.
• Do not attach paper or tape to disc.
• Fingerprints and dust on the disc cause pic ture and sound deterioration. Wipe the disc from
the centre outwards with a soft cloth. Always keep the disc clean.
• If you cannot wipe off the dust with a soft cloth, wipe the disc lightly with a slightly moistened soft cloth and nish with a dry cloth.
• Do not use any type of solvent such as thinner, benzene, commercially available cleaners or antistatic spray for vinyl. It may damage the disc.
• Do not store discs in a place subject to direct sunlight or near heat source.
• Do not store discs i n a pl ace subject to mo isture and dus t s uch as a bathroom or ne ar a humidier.
• Store discs vertically in a case, stacking or placing object on discs outside or their case may
cause warping.
• Norm ally, Blu-ray / DVD discs are divi ded into titles, and the t itles are sub-div ided into
chapters. Audio CD discs are divided into tracks.
• Each title, chapter, or track is assigned a number, which is called title number, chapter number or track number respectively. There may be discs that do not have these numbers.

Warning
• The unit should not be placed near a TV, radio or VCR, the playback picture may become
poor and the sound may be distorted.
• The pick up may be condensed with water under the following situation.
• From a cold place to warm place
• Operates in a room where the heater is just turned on, or a place where the cold air from the
air conditioner directly hits the unit.
• During summer, the unit moves from an air conditioned room to a hot and humid place.
• A room is vaporous or damp.
• If condensation exists, the unit will not operate properly. Remove the disc, power up the unit and leave it for two to three hours. The unit will warm up and evaporate any moisture.

High-Denition entertainment
Watch high-denition content disc with HDTV (High Denition Television). Connect it through a high speed HDMI cable (1.4 or category 2). You can enjoy excellent picture quality up to 1080p
resolution with the frame rate of 24 frames per second with progressive scan output.
BONUSVIEW/PIP (Picture-in-Picture)
Thi s is a new funct ion of BD- Vide o t hat pla ys the prim ary vid eo and seco ndary vid eo simultaneously.Blu-ray players with Final Standard Prole or Prole 1.1 specs can play Bonus
View features.
BD-Live
Connect this product to the movie studios website via the LAN port to access a variety of up-to-
date content (e.g. refreshed previews and exclusive special features). You can also enjoy next generation possibilities, such as ringtone/wa llpaper downloads, peer-to-peer interactions, li ve
events and gaming activities.
Upscale DVD for enhanced picture quality
Watch the discs in the highest picture quality available for the HDTV. Video upscaling increases the resolution of standard denition disc to high denition up to 1080p over an HDMI connection.
A highly detailed picture and increased sharpness delivers a more true-to-life picture.

Region Management Information
This Blu-ray Player is de signed a nd manuf acture d to respo nd to the Reg ion Managemen t Information that is recorded on a Blu-ray disc. If the Region number described on the Blu-ray disc does not correspond to the Region number of this Blu-ray Player, this Blu-ray player cannot
play that disc.
